UNION COUNTY COLLEGE Summer I Semester 2007 GENERAL INFORMATION: Summer Session I is a six week semester beginning on Monday, May 21 and ending on Thursday, June 28. We meet on Mondays, Tuesdays, and Thursdays. Each class is two hours and thirty minutes long. The course covers all the material taught usually in a fifteen week semester. There is a considerable amount of reading involved in this course. This is a difficult course to take during the summer semester. Please do not fall behind in your readings. Class attendance is taken and counts toward your grade. There are three examinations; one at the end of each two week segment. The final on June 28 will be comprehensive.
